Edited by: Darknesss on 28/08/2011 13:27:21 Reasons PvP once required skill and an advanced understanding of ships capabilities and game mechanics. These mechanics are very rarely required or used these days due to the mentality of 'lets repair so much none of us die even when we make stupid mistakes'.
A small group of people will often in a game with as many people on a single server come up against larger groups of people. I have no issue with this, if you fly in a small group it should require better skill to combat large groups, but it should always be possible (within reason) to take them on.
With the use of remote repair a small group of people often end up utterly powerless to kill a single ship because of the large volume of logistics ships. A gang can quite happily go up against your small group safe in the knowledge that the enemy simply cannot do the required DPS to break their reps or cause them any meaningful damage. This was a benefit to smaller groups in the past as only the smaller groups tended to really use them, but this has changed and now they are common place in 99% of gangs whether they be small or large.
The only way to get kills is to rely on the enemy making mistakes by flying out of rep range or getting caught away from the gang, or failure on part of the logistics pilot. A game where combat is defined solely on the hope that the enemy will make a mistake is a broken game. As important as mistakes are in combat, pilot skill should be equally if not more important.
I believe it is one of the key reasons as to why we see hardly any battleship gangs (in particular smaller battleship gangs) and why we have this capitals online dilemma. Spider tanking carriers/supercarriers have so much repair ability that grows exponentially as more join the gang, and are in many cases (not all, but many) practically invulnerable to support gangs.
So what are my proposals: 1) Introduce a system where by large remote repair modules only work on battleship class and larger, medium on battlecruiser/cruiser sized ships and larger and small on frigate class ships and larger 2) Change capital remote repairers to a structure (pos mod etc) only repair module 3) Increase the cycle time of remote repair modules so that smaller ships become vulnerable again
What result I believe this will have: Realism - If there are several hundred people in a fight it SHOULD be chaos with people dropping like flies. Supercapitals - With their significant buffer will still be tough but more will die, given the volume being pumped in to the game this again is a good thing. Capitals - Will now have a significant weakness to mobile support fleets and will no longer be invulnerable, hopefully bringing back a bit of tactical thought provoking warfare. People would be less inclined to throw 5-6 carriers at a 10-15 man roaming gangs. Capitals Part 2 (Dreads) - Since DPS will be more important than repair you would hopefully see an increase in the use of Dreads as anti capital ship weapons which as a class have severely declined in usage. Battleships - Will become a widely used ship again, with their higher buffer and ability to have large remote repairer modules used on them they will be back in fashion. Remote repair battleship slugfests were possibly the most enjoyable combat in the game, I and I'm sure most people would love this to happen again.
Helping the economy - More ships will die - decreasing the amount of ISK going into the game and helping the economy (ISK is really inflated).
Possible negative affect of the change: NPC'ing, in particular plexes and wormholes which rely heavily on remote repair. Not intentional on my part but I'm sure there is a way around it.
In summary, Small, organized and smart combat needs a come back. Combat for combats sake, not just for monetary gain and greed.
